Ruskin, John, 1819-1900. A.L.S. to Francesca Alexander. Herne Hill, England., 28 April 1884
Advises Francesca to rest; sounds proofs; tells of his visit to the Duchess of Claremont, his paintings at the Watercolour Society, etc. gives specific recommendations for painting and drawing; warns not to sell coloured drawing etc. 2 s. (8 p.)
Ruskin, John, 1819-1900. A.L.S. to Francesca Alexander. Herne Hill, England., 29 April 1884
Questions on stories Francesca has sent; wishes he knew more Italian; will renew work on book the next week. 1 s. (2 p.)
Ruskin, John, 1819-1900. A.L.S. to Francesca Alexander. Brantwood, Cumbria, England., 6 May 1884
Details of printing book etc.; loves owls; encloses song written for shepardess. 2 s. (3 p.)
Enclosed one sheet of music, in Ruskin's writing.
Ruskin, John, 1819-1900. A.L.S. to Francesca Alexander. Brantwood, Cumbria, England., 7 May 1884
Comments on drawings; says work for Francesca new and important stimulus to his life; warns her to rest. 2 s. (3 p.)
Enclosed a page of proof corrections by Ruskin.
Ruskin, John, 1819-1900. A.L.S. to Francesca Alexander. Brantwood, Cumbria, England., 9 May 1884
Sends proofs of Ballad to Francesca for her corrections. 1 s. (2 p.)
